👨👩👧 "I fight for my family", — 33-year-old gunner Vitaly on the Swedish CV90 BMP
He joined the Armed Forces as a volunteer in 2022. At that time, he did not even think about where exactly he would end up - in which unit and in which position.
"I don't want the enemy to come to my house, that's why I'm here. Of course, it is scary. But we all clearly know what we are fighting for,
Vitaly explains.
First, he learned to be a BMP-1 gunner, then while studying abroad he mastered the Swedish model. He tells how he hit the enemy from his car:
"They went on the offensive. And we had very clear coordination and interaction with intelligence. We got the coordinates and I collapsed from a closed position. From the first shot - on target. And they started running away."
